A Cheektowaga man has pleaded guilty to a hit-and-run crash that killed a teenager last summer.

Paul Hintermeier, 37, pleaded guilty Thursday morning in State Supreme Court to vehicular manslaughter and leaving the scene of a deadly accident.

On August 11, Hintermeier was driving with a blood alcohol level at twice the legal limit when he ran a stop sign, hitting bicyclist Damian Garra as he crossed Shanley Street. Garra, 18, later died from his injuries.

Hintermeier will be sentenced in March and faces up to 11 years in prison.  He was originally facing a sentence of up to 14 years in prison.
